Embracing new normal with IR4.0


Lim (right) observing the use of IoT sensors to collect data from the production line during his visit to Sydney cake House’s new plant in Klang.

THE International Trade and Industry Ministry is encouraging local companies to leverage on the use of technology and embrace the new normal during the Covid-19 pandemic.

Its deputy minister Datuk Lim Ban Hong said the government had drawn up plans to assist small and medium enterprises to undergo the digital transformation.
